This substantial detached family home is ideally located within easy reach of the highly sought-after Avenue Primary Academy and Harris Academy. Offering generous proportions throughout, the property benefits from off-street parking for multiple vehicles and an impressive 86ft west-facing rear garden, complete with a secluded area perfect for a home office, studio, or keen gardeners.
Beautifully presented and well-maintained, the home provides bright and airy living spaces. The ground floor features an elegant reception hall with parquet flooring, a spacious front-facing dining room with a large bay window, a welcoming living room with a feature fireplace, a downstairs cloakroom/WC and a contemporary fitted kitchen with space for dining and Crittall-style doors opening onto the garden.
Upstairs, the property offers four well-proportioned bedrooms, including a principal bedroom with en-suite shower room, along with a recently renovated family shower room.
Externally, the rear garden enjoys a desirable westerly aspect and offers a high degree of privacy. Immediately to the rear of the house is a patio area, ideal for outdoor dining, leading onto a large lawn and a charming hidden section with a greenhouse and storage shed. To the front, the driveway provides ample off-street parking and gives access to the garage.
Locally, Cheam Village and Belmont Village offer a variety of shops, cafés and restaurants, while Sutton town centre provides a more extensive range of shopping facilities and supermarkets. Commuters will benefit from nearby Belmont, Cheam and Sutton stations, all providing easy access to Central London. Additional amenities include bus routes to surrounding areas, the picturesque parkland of Nonsuch Park, and a number of leisure centres.
